I've run radial laced 48's on my flatland bike for a while with zero issues. The deal with that is to only radial lace the non-drive side. Just as an F.Y.I., I'm not a super smooth rider, and at around 220 while riding I wasn't real light either....
Now back on task, front spool wheels laced Radially don't do too horribly, but you have to keep up on the spoke tension more than with the cross laced wheels.
Oh, and as mentioned already, Do not radial lace a rear wheel on a motorcycle. EVER

Show us a picture of said "Radial Laced" wheels stock on those bikes. I've seen the wheels in person and while they aren't the typical "Cross" lacing, they are a modified version of a torsionally laced wheel. Radial spokes are directed straight out of the hub, at a 90 degree relative angle to the rotational forces of the wheel. The spoke sides(drive and non-drive side) on those wheels are actually pulling against each other , helping to add structural rigidity to the wheel. The spokes pulling against each other on those wheels help to fight the forces being placed on the wheel by braking/drive drain pull.
